
District Vision Linto Gravel Rider Sunglasses - Tortoise
The Linto Gravel Rider marks new territory for District Vision, designed alongside LAās renowned Golden Saddle Cyclery. Recalling heritage cycling glasses and the D+ Earth Vision Polarised lens and titanium armature and hardware. Finished with a heritage titanium badge and DVās adjustable and hypoallergenic rubber nose pad and temple tips.
With a distinctive vision of what sport eyewear could and should be, District Vision deliver contemporary designs developed for the modern athlete. Taking a holistic approach to design in their native California, in unison with real-world feedback from athletes and precision engineering in Japan.
